**14:22** — The Quillpress incremental rebuild queue began skipping pages whose only change came from third-party plugin hooks. Plugin authors saw stale output on the Marrowgate demo site for roughly forty minutes. We rolled back the dependency-graph pruning change and rebuilt affected pages. The trace token for the rollback build is recorded below for cross-referencing.

build token for kagaf-hahof: htk14_9d3d4d26d7d8de

Subject: Handover — nightly reindex

Taking over from me: the Lanternfish reindex failed twice this week at the shard-merge step. Workaround: rerun with `--skip-warm`. Root cause suspected in the tokenizer upgrade; rollback branch is staged. Watch disk on indexer-3, it's near 85%. If the merge stalls again, don't restart mid-run — ping the search platform folks first.

alerts address for kajog-tadup: druox@plorvanet.internal

Key Ceremony Checklist — Item 7 (Marletta Dispatch). Before signing the release of the driver-assignment heuristic module, confirm the weighting table matches the ceremony transcript and that both custodians have initialed the scoring changes. Once the quorum is seated, the release manager unlocks the signing partition using the passphrase recorded immediately below.

vault phrase of bagaf-kajeg = jorath-feniel-briir-siliel-ralix

- [ ] Step 9 — SlimCrate image-slimming pipeline. Heads up for the security reviewer: this is the part of the ceremony where we rotate the key that signs our slimmed base images. Confirm the old signing key is revoked in the registry, the new key's fingerprint matches the witness sheet, and the build bots picked it up. One quirk: the offline signer box won't boot its enclave without manual auth, so after revocation is confirmed, enter the recovery passphrase shown just below.

unlock words, kajeg-fahif: holmir-casael-novdor